Message to the operator is given from outside the NC, and the message
is displayed.
The message is sent after a message number 0 to 999. Either a message
consisting of up to 255 characters or up to four messages each consisting
of up to 63 characters can be displayed at the same time by parameter
setting.
The message numbers 0 to 99 are displayed along with the message.
To distinguish these alarms from other alarms, the CNC displays them by
adding 2000 to each alarm number. When a message from 100 to 999 is
displayed, the message number is not displayed; only its text is displayed.
An external data will clear the operator messages.
The number of required parts and the number of machined parts can be
preset externally. Values from 0 to 9999 can be preset.
